ACC 501 Financial Accounting
Credits: 3(3-0-0) Prerequisite: None
The course is designed to develop an understanding of accounting
principles based on basic concepts and methods used in corporate
financial statement. Major topics include: the basic accrual model, analysis
of transactions, balance sheet, income statement and cash flow statement
construction and analysis. The course is expected to enable students to
analyze the actual financial reports and understand how basic concepts
and methods of financial accounting are applied to issues such as long-term
assets, inventory, sales, receivables, debt securities, corporate ownership,
international operations, and analysis of financial statements.
ACC 520 Managerial Accounting
Credits: 3(3-0-0) Prerequisite: ACC 501
The course deals with the tools and techniques for internal use of
accounting information for managerial decisions. It specifically focuses on
cost accumulations and analyses, alternative costing methods, accounting
aspects of planning, budgeting and budgetary control, financial and non-
financial performance evaluations, and other relevant uses of accounting
information in the decision-making process.
